Heim  >  Artikel  >  Backend-Entwicklung  >  So geben Sie den Gleitkommatyp in Python ein

So geben Sie den Gleitkommatyp in Python ein

zbt
zbtOriginal
2023-12-12 16:51:233017Durchsuche

Python-Gleitkommatypen können durch direkte Zuweisung, Verwendung der wissenschaftlichen Notation, Umwandlung, Verwendung von Eingabefunktionen und Berechnungen erhalten werden. Detaillierte Einführung: 1. Direkte Zuweisung: Weisen Sie einer Variablen eine Dezimalzahl zu. Python erkennt den Typ der Zahl automatisch als Gleitkommazahl. 2. Verwenden Sie die wissenschaftliche Notation, um eine Zahl in der Form M x 10^N auszudrücken. Wobei M ist eine Dezimalzahl oder eine Ganzzahl, N ist eine Ganzzahl. 3. Erzwungene Typkonvertierung. Verwenden Sie die Funktion float(), um die Typkonvertierung durchzuführen. Konvertieren Sie die Ganzzahl in eine Gleitkommazahl. 4. Verwenden Sie die Eingabefunktion.

So geben Sie den Gleitkommatyp in Python ein

Das Betriebssystem dieses Tutorials: Windows 10-System, Python-Version 3.11.4, DELL G3-Computer.

In Python sind Gleitkommadaten ein Datentyp, der zur Darstellung von Dezimalzahlen oder Zahlen mit Dezimalpunkten verwendet wird. Gleitkommadaten können in Python auf viele Arten eingegeben werden:

1. Direkte Zuweisung

Die einfachste Möglichkeit besteht darin, einer Variablen direkt eine Dezimalzahl zuzuweisen, und Python erkennt automatisch den Typ der Zahl als Gleitkomma. Beispiel:

my_float = 3.14

2. Wissenschaftliche Notation verwenden

Python ermöglicht die Verwendung der wissenschaftlichen Notation zur Darstellung einer Zahl in der Form M x 10^N, wobei M eine Dezimalzahl oder ist eine ganze Zahl. N ist eine ganze Zahl. Zum Beispiel:

my_float = 6.022e23 # 表示阿伏伽德罗常数,6.022 x 10的23次方

3. Erzwungene Typkonvertierung

Manchmal müssen wir eine Ganzzahl in Gleitkommadaten konvertieren. In Python können Sie die Typkonvertierung durchführen und die Ganzzahl in eine Gleitkommazahl konvertieren Punktnummer. Zum Beispiel:

my_float = float(5) # 将整数5转换成浮点型,结果为5.0

4. Eingabefunktion verwenden

In einem tatsächlichen Programm müssen wir möglicherweise Gleitkommaeingaben vom Benutzer erhalten. Python verfügt über eine integrierte Funktion „input()“, mit der Benutzer eine Zeichenfolge eingeben und diese dann mit der Funktion „float()“ in einen Gleitkommatyp konvertieren können. Zum Beispiel:

my_float = float(input("请输入一个浮点数: "))

5. Berechnen

Gleitkommazahlen können beispielsweise auch berechnet werden. Das Ergebnis der Division zweier Ganzzahlen ist normalerweise eine Gleitkommazahl. Zum Beispiel:

result = 10 / 3 # 结果为3.33333333333

Zusätzlich zu den oben genannten Operationen gibt es in Python noch andere Methoden zum Betreiben von Gleitkommazahlen, z. B. Runden, Runden usw.

Da der interne Speicher von Gleitkommazahlen im Computer begrenzt ist, ist zu beachten, dass es zu Präzisionsverlusten kommen kann. Beispielsweise werden einige Dezimalzahlen auf einem Computer möglicherweise nicht genau dargestellt, was zu Rundungsfehlern führt. Daher muss bei der tatsächlichen Programmierung besondere Sorgfalt bei der Berechnung von Gleitkommazahlen angewendet werden, um Programmfehler aufgrund von Genauigkeitsproblemen zu vermeiden.

Kurz gesagt, Gleitkommadaten in Python können durch direkte Zuweisung, wissenschaftliche Notation, erzwungene Typkonvertierung, Benutzereingabe und andere Methoden eingegeben werden. Diese flexiblen Eingabemethoden machen die Verarbeitung von Gleitkommazahlen in Python komfortabler und effizienter.

Das obige ist der detaillierte Inhalt vonSo geben Sie den Gleitkommatyp in Python ein.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n